Beyond the translation

Song interpretation

This inspiring song from 'Ennaipol Oruvan' (1978) serves as a moral guide and motivational anthem addressed to children and youth. The protagonist addresses the young generation as the future leaders and protectors of the nation, emphasizing that moral principles, truth, love, and unity are paramount to building a strong character and society. It pays homage to visionary national leaders like Mahatma Gandhi, Jawaharlal Nehru, and K. Kamaraj (referred to as the poor leader who gave schools).

Writing craft

Poetic devices

Metaphor (Uruvagandhal)

Thangangalae naalai thalaivargal

Children are metaphorically addressed as 'Thangangal' (Gold) and 'Singangal' (Lions), representing their innocence, high value, and courage.

Simile / Analogy

Nam thaayum mozhiyum kangal

Mother and mother tongue are equated to 'kangal' (eyes), underscoring their vital importance to one's existence.

Edhugai (Second-letter Rhyming)

Endrum ondrey seiyyungal / Ondrum nandrae seiyyungal / Nandrum indrae seiyyungal

Rhyming of the second letter 'n' in 'Endrum', 'Ondrum', and 'Nandrum'.

Alliteration (Monaai)

Aram seiyya virumbu endraal / Avvai tharumam seiyyungal

Repetition of initial consonants or vowels across words ('Aram', 'Avvai', 'Anbe').

Did you know?

Trivia

The line 'Kalvi saalai thantha yaezhai thalaivanai' explicitly honors Former Chief Minister of Tamil Nadu K. Kamaraj, known for introducing the Midday Meal Scheme and revolutionizing free school education across the state. The song features M. G. Ramachandran (MGR) in one of his final films before becoming Chief Minister full-time.
